Output 74d937a79beb2674072819612f50b03dbe754cd83d3f2de406c6bc2162f83127:0

value
265944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 663cc68694e068d600311e36859dab6791f02fc8 OP_EQUAL
address
3B1besA9XfJQyK94X31gUJsDvAzfENxoRd
transaction
74d937a79beb2674072819612f50b03dbe754cd83d3f2de406c6bc2162f83127
spent
true